Space database options
This topic summarizes each detail space trending option and its corresponding SETSRM keywords, action line commands, and EZCmd menus.
With all Space Utilization views, you can use the TIME command to set date and time ranges for the reporting period when displaying a single resource. For information about using the TIME command, see the Using-MainView-products or type Help TIME on the COMMAND line to access online Help.

Space Intervals | Advances to the CIS records view. This view displays all the CIS records that are in the space collector database. The view includes the date and time of an interval, the number of records in the interval, and the type of interval. A CIS record can be selected to hyperlink to related views, based on the type of CIS record.
